.textoTit1 {
	font-family: Sedgwick Ave Display;
	font-size: 50px;
	color: #FFF;
	font-weight: bold;
}

.textoTit2 {
	font-family: Bungee;
	font-size: 10px;
	color: #333333;
	font-weight: bold;
}

.bordeNaranja {
	border: 2px solid #FE7F00;
	background-color: #FFF;
}
.bordeNaranjaInferior {
	border-bottom-width: 2px;
	border-bottom-style: solid;
	border-bottom-color: #FE7F00;
}
.bordeNaranjaInferiorFino {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FE7F00;
}

.bordeAmarilloInferior {
	border-bottom-width: 2px;
	border-bottom-style: solid;
	border-bottom-color: #ffad00;
}

.bordeNaranjaIzq {
	border-left-width: 2px;
	border-left-style: solid;
	border-left-color: #FE7F00;
}
.textoBungee10 {
	font-family: Bungee;
	font-size: 10px;
	color: #333333;
	font-weight: bold;
}
.textoKavivanar2 {
	font-family: Kavivanar;
	font-size: 15px;
	color: #333333;
	font-weight: bold;
}

.textoBungee15 {
	font-family: Bungee;
	font-size: 15px;
	color: #000000;
	font-weight: bold;
}
.textoKavivanar1 {
	font-family: Kavivanar;
	font-size: 25px;
	color: #000000;
	font-weight: bold;
}
.textoMcLaren1 {
	font-family: McLaren;
	font-size: 22px;
	color: #000000;
	font-weight: bold;
}
.textoMontserrat {
	font-family: Montserrat;
	font-size: 22px;
	color: #000000;
	font-weight: bold;
}
.textoUnica1 {
	font-family: "Unica one";
	font-size: 25px;
	color: #000000;
	font-weight: bold;
}
.textoUnica2 {
	font-family: "Unica one";
	font-size: 15px;
	color: #000000;
	font-weight: bold;
}


.textoMcLaren2 {
	font-family: McLaren;
	font-size: 15px;
	color: #000000;
	font-weight: bold;
}
.textoMcLaren {
	font-family: McLaren;
	color: #000000;
}
.textoBungee {
	font-family: Bungee;
	color: #000000;
}
.textoWalter {
	font-family: Walter Turncoat;
	color: #000000;
}
.textoHandlee {
	font-family: Handlee;
	color: #000000;
}
.textoBubble {
	font-family: Bubblegum Sans;
	color: #000000;
}
.textoProsto {
	font-family: Prosto One;
	color: #000000;
}
.negrita {
	font-weight: bold;
}
.t11 {
	font-size: 11px;
}
.t10 {
	font-size: 10px;
}
.t9 {
	font-size: 9px;
}
.t8 {
	font-size: 8px;
}
.t12 {
	font-size: 12px;
}
.t13 {
	font-size: 13px;
}
.t14 {
	font-size: 14px;
}
.t15 {
	font-size: 15px;
}
.t16 {
	font-size: 16px;
}
.t18 {
	font-size: 18px;
}
.t17 {
	font-size: 17px;
}
.t20 {
	font-size: 20px;
}
.t25 {
	font-size: 25px;
}
.t30 {
	font-size: 30px;
}
.t40 {
	font-size: 40px;
}
.t50 {
	font-size: 50px;
}








.textoMcLaren2Borde {
	font-family: McLaren;
	font-size: 15px;
	color: #000000;
	font-weight: bold;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-bottom-style: solid;
	border-top-color: #36C;
	border-right-color: #36C;
	border-bottom-color: #36C;
	border-left-color: #36C;
}
.blanco {
	color: #FFF;
}
.verde {
	color: #060;
}
.fondo-verde{
	background-color: #060;
}
.naranja {
	color: #FE7F00;
}
.fondo-naranja{
	background-color: #FE7F00;
}
.naranjaFuerte {
	color: #e94e02;
}

.gris_oscuro {
	color: #666666;
}

.gris_oscuro2 {
	color: #332D2D;
}

.lilaTutor {
	color: #4F52BA;
}

.gris {
	color: #999999;
}

.rojo {
	color: #990000;
}
.fondo-rojo{
	background-color: #990000;
}
.fondo-amarillo{
	background-color: #F0E80B;
}
.azulgrafico {
	color: #4284F3;
}
.fondo-azulgrafico{
	background-color: #4284F3;
}

.textoBubblegum2 {
	font-family: "Bubblegum Sans";
	font-size: 15px;
	color: #000000;
	font-weight: bold;
}
.textoHandlee2 {
	font-family: Handlee;
	font-size: 15px;
	color: #000000;
	font-weight: bold;
}
.textoIndie2 {
	font-family: "Indie Flower";
	font-size: 20px;
	color: #000000;
	font-weight: bold;
}
.textoWalterTurncoat {
	font-family: "Walter Turncoat";
	font-size: 10px;	
}
.textoComingSoon {
	font-family: "Coming Soon";
	font-size: 20px;
	color: #000000;
	font-weight: bold;
}
.textoPatrick2 {
	font-family: "Patrick Hand";
	font-size: 15px;
	color: #000000;
	font-weight: bold;
}
.mayus {
	text-transform: uppercase;
}
.circular-vertical {
  background-color: #6164C1;
  position: relative;
  width: 100px;
  height: 110px;
  overflow: hidden;
  border-radius: 50%;
  border: 4px solid #F2B33F;
}

.circular-vertical img {
  width: 105%;
  height: auto;
}
.circular-vertical-rojo {
	background-color: #C65B5F;
	position: relative;
	width: 100px;
	height: 110px;
	overflow: hidden;
	border-radius: 50%;
	border: 4px solid #990000;
}

.circular-vertical-rojo img {
  width: 105%;
  height: auto;
}

.circular-vertical-peq {
  background-color: #6164C1;
  position: relative;
  width: 80px;
  height: 90px;
  overflow: hidden;
  border-radius: 50%;
  border: 4px solid #F2B33F;
}

.circular-vertical-peq img {
  width: 105%;
  height: auto;
}

.circular-vertical-peq-rojo {
  background-color: #C65B5F;
  position: relative;
  width: 80px;
  height: 90px;
  overflow: hidden;
  border-radius: 50%;
  border: 4px solid #990000;
}

.circular-vertical-peq-rojo img {
  width: 105%;
  height: auto;
}

.circular-vertical-peq2 {
  background-color: #6164C1;
  position: relative;
  width: 70px;
  height: 80px;
  overflow: hidden;
  border-radius: 50%;
  border: 4px solid #F2B33F;
}

.circular-vertical-peq2 img {
  width: 105%;
  height: auto;
}

.fondo-lila1{
	background-color: #6164C1;
}

.fondo-lila1-rojo{
	background-color: #C65B5F;
}
.fondo-lilaTit{
	background-color: rgb(79, 82, 186);
	height:40px;
	text-align:center;
}

.fondo-lilaTit-rojo{
	background-color: rgb(188,78,81);
	height: 40px;
	text-align: center;
}
.fondo-grisAbajo{
	background-color: #e4e4e4;
	height:40px;
	vertical-align:middle;
	
}
.fondo-grisAbajoBordeSup {
	background-color: #e4e4e4;
	height: 40px;
	vertical-align: middle;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#666;
}
.altura40{
	height:40px;
}

.bordesLat{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#666;
	border-left-color: #666;
}
.bordesGris {
	background-color: #FFF;
	border: 1px solid #666;
}

.FondoGrisBordesGris {
	background-color: #e4e4e4;
	border: 1px solid #666;
}

.tbl_sep1 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 5px;
}
.tbl_sep_min {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 3px;
}
.tbl_sep2 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 7px;
}
.tbl_sep2_bordeInf {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 7px;
	border-bottom-width: thin;
	border-bottom-style: solid;
	border-bottom-color: #4F52BA;
}

.tbl_sep3 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 14px;
}
.alto2 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 2px;
}
.alto4 {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 4px;
}

.azul_timon {
	color: #2196f3;
}

.rosa_timon {
	color: #f22097;
}

.naranja_timon {
	color: #ff8400;
}

.amarillo_timon {
	color: #ffad00;
}

.verde_timon {
	color: #78be1f;
}

.gris_timon {
	color: #918c8c;
}

.gris_timon2 {
	color: #c8c8c8;
}

.lila {
	color: #7D3C98;
}

.tachado {
	text-decoration:line-through;
}

.Ruda {
	font-family: 'Ruda';
}

.amarillo_convivencia {
	color: #FEAC00;
}

.confirmacion{background:#C6FFD5;border:1px solid green;}
.negacion{background:#ffcccc;border:1px solid red}

.fondo_fila_lomloe {
	background-color: #4284F3;
	color: #FFF;
}

.zoom{
	transition: 0.7s ease-in;
	 -moz-transition: 0.7s ease-in; /* Firefox */
	 -webkit-transition: 0.7s ease-in; /* Chrome - Safari */
	 -o-transition: 0.7s ease-in; /* Opera */
}
.zoom:hover{
	transform : scale(2.7) translateY(20px) translateX(-5px);
	-moz-transform : scale(2.7) translateY(20px) translateX(-5px); /* Firefox */
	-webkit-transform : scale(2.7) translateY(20px) translateX(-5px); /* Chrome - Safari */
	-o-transform : scale(2.7) translateY(20px) translateX(-5px); /* Opera */
	-ms-transform : scale(2.7) translateY(20px) translateX(-5px); /* IE9 */
}
